What is a Polyurethane Sealant?

Polyurethane sealants are a type of adhesive sealant that is composed of polyurethane polymers. These polymers, when combined with other ingredients, form a highly elastic and durable sealant. It is commonly used to seal joints and gaps in different construction materials, including wood, metal, concrete, and plastic. Polyurethane sealants come in both one-part and two-part formulations, depending on the project´s requirements.

Benefits of Using Polyurethane Sealants

There are several reasons why polyurethane sealants are preferred over other sealant options. Some of the key benefits include:

  1. High Flexibility: Polyurethane sealants have excellent elasticity, making them ideal for applications where the materials need to move or flex, such as floors, roofs, and walls. They can stretch up to 700% of their original size and still maintain their bond, making them suitable for areas prone to vibrations or movements.

  2. Water Resistance: Another significant advantage of polyurethane sealants is their ability to resist water and moisture. This makes them perfect for use in areas that are exposed to water or high humidity levels, such as bathrooms, kitchens, and swimming pools.

  3. Excellent Adhesion: Polyurethane sealants have strong adhesive properties, making them suitable for a wide range of surfaces. They can bond with different materials, including concrete, metal, wood, and plastic, providing a secure and long-lasting seal.

  4. UV Resistance: Polyurethane sealants are resistant to UV rays, making them suitable for outdoor applications where exposure to sunlight is inevitable. They do not degrade or lose their elasticity under extremeheat or sunlight, ensuring long-term durability.

Applications of Polyurethane Sealants

Polyurethane sealants have a wide range of applications in the construction and building industry. Some of the common uses include:

  1. Window and Door Installation: Polyurethane sealants are commonly used to seal gaps around windows and doors, providing an airtight and waterproof seal.

  2. Flooring: Polyurethane sealants are ideal for sealing joints and cracks in floors, providing a smooth and level surface. They are also resistant to wear and tear, making them suitable for high traffic areas.

  3. Roofing: The elasticity of polyurethane sealants makes them perfect for sealing and repairing roof leaks. They can withstand harsh weather conditions and remain flexible, preventing further damage.

  4. Expansion Joints: Polyurethane sealants are used to seal expansion joints in buildings, bridges, and highways. They can stretch and compress without losing their bond, allowing for natural movement of the structures.

Choosing the Right Polyurethane Sealant

When selecting a polyurethane sealant, there are a few factors to consider to ensure the best results. These include:

  1. Type of Project: Determine whether the project requires a one-part or two-part polyurethane sealant. One-part sealants are ready to use, while two-part sealants require mixing before application.

  2. Environmental Factors: Consider the temperature, humidity, and exposure to the elements when choosing a polyurethane sealant. Certain types are more suitable for outdoor or indoor use, and some have specific temperature requirements during application.

  3. Application Method: Polyurethane sealants can be applied using a caulk gun or with a brush or trowel. Consider the best method for your project when selecting a sealant.
